Occupational Employment and Wages, May 2009; bls.gov • Computer Hardware Engineers -$108k • Software Engineers -$90k • Electrical Engineering- $86k • Mechanical Engineering-$85k • Computer Science - $82k • Computer Programmers-$72k • http://data.bls.gov/cgi-bin/print.pl/oes/current/naics4_541300.htm
